摘要
Electrochemical polarization of metal electrodes on solid electrolytes may result in a pronounced promotion of their catalytic activity. A phenomenological analysis of this promotion effect is developed from simple thermodynamic and kinetic arguments and is compared with existing models. The strong modification of catalytic activity is related to the electrochemically controlled change of the chemical potential of a mobile component at the electrode interface within the (solid state) galvanic cell. Empirical relations reported in the literature are interpreted in terms of this chemical potential change.
